net/ice/base: clean code in flow director module
Remove unused macro and function. Declare no external referenced function as static. Signed-off-by: Paul M Stillwell Jr <paul.m.stillwell.jr@intel.com> Signed-off-by: Qi Zhang <qi.z.zhang@intel.com> Acked-by: Qiming Yang <qiming.yang@intel.com>
This commit is contained in:
parent
946a5337b2
commit
6857fdaff5
@ -597,7 +597,7 @@ static const struct ice_fdir_base_pkt ice_fdir_pkt[] = {
|
||||
* ice_set_dflt_val_fd_desc
|
||||
* @fd_fltr_ctx: pointer to fd filter descriptor
|
||||
*/
|
||||
void ice_set_dflt_val_fd_desc(struct ice_fd_fltr_desc_ctx *fd_fltr_ctx)
|
||||
static void ice_set_dflt_val_fd_desc(struct ice_fd_fltr_desc_ctx *fd_fltr_ctx)
|
||||
{
|
||||
fd_fltr_ctx->comp_q = ICE_FXD_FLTR_QW0_COMP_Q_ZERO;
|
||||
fd_fltr_ctx->comp_report = ICE_FXD_FLTR_QW0_COMP_REPORT_SW_FAIL;
|
||||
@ -1388,27 +1388,6 @@ bool ice_fdir_is_dup_fltr(struct ice_hw *hw, struct ice_fdir_fltr *input)
|
||||
return ret;
|
||||
}
|
||||
|
||||
/**
|
||||
* ice_clear_vsi_fd_table - admin command to clear FD table for a VSI
|
||||
* @hw: hardware data structure
|
||||
* @vsi_num: vsi_num (HW VSI num)
|
||||
*
|
||||
* Clears FD table entries by issuing admin command (direct, 0x0B06)
|
||||
* Must to pass valid vsi_num as returned by "AddVSI".
|
||||
*/
|
||||
enum ice_status ice_clear_vsi_fd_table(struct ice_hw *hw, u16 vsi_num)
|
||||
{
|
||||
struct ice_aqc_clear_fd_table *cmd;
|
||||
struct ice_aq_desc desc;
|
||||
|
||||
cmd = &desc.params.clear_fd_table;
|
||||
ice_fill_dflt_direct_cmd_desc(&desc, ice_aqc_opc_clear_fd_table);
|
||||
cmd->clear_type = CL_FD_VM_VF_TYPE_VSI_IDX;
|
||||
|
||||
cmd->vsi_index = CPU_TO_LE16(vsi_num);
|
||||
return ice_aq_send_cmd(hw, &desc, NULL, 0, NULL);
|
||||
}
|
||||
|
||||
/**
|
||||
* ice_clear_pf_fd_table - admin command to clear FD table for PF
|
||||
* @hw: hardware data structure
|
||||
|
@ -17,7 +17,6 @@
|
||||
#define ICE_FDIR_TUN_PKT_OFF 50
|
||||
#define ICE_FDIR_MAX_RAW_PKT_SIZE (512 + ICE_FDIR_TUN_PKT_OFF)
|
||||
#define ICE_FDIR_BUF_FULL_MARGIN 10
|
||||
#define ICE_FDIR_BUF_HEAD_ROOM 32
|
||||
|
||||
/* macros for offsets into packets for flow director programming */
|
||||
#define ICE_IPV4_SRC_ADDR_OFFSET 26
|
||||
@ -222,7 +221,6 @@ struct ice_fdir_base_pkt {
|
||||
|
||||
enum ice_status ice_alloc_fd_res_cntr(struct ice_hw *hw, u16 *cntr_id);
|
||||
enum ice_status ice_free_fd_res_cntr(struct ice_hw *hw, u16 cntr_id);
|
||||
void ice_set_dflt_val_fd_desc(struct ice_fd_fltr_desc_ctx *fd_fltr_ctx);
|
||||
enum ice_status
|
||||
ice_alloc_fd_guar_item(struct ice_hw *hw, u16 *cntr_id, u16 num_fltr);
|
||||
enum ice_status
|
||||
@ -231,7 +229,6 @@ enum ice_status
|
||||
ice_alloc_fd_shrd_item(struct ice_hw *hw, u16 *cntr_id, u16 num_fltr);
|
||||
enum ice_status
|
||||
ice_free_fd_shrd_item(struct ice_hw *hw, u16 cntr_id, u16 num_fltr);
|
||||
enum ice_status ice_clear_vsi_fd_table(struct ice_hw *hw, u16 vsi_num);
|
||||
enum ice_status ice_clear_pf_fd_table(struct ice_hw *hw);
|
||||
void
|
||||
ice_fdir_get_prgm_desc(struct ice_hw *hw, struct ice_fdir_fltr *input,
|
||||
|
Loading…
Reference in New Issue
Block a user